port regulation
The legal standards and regulations applicable to ports, based primarily on municipal laws, port laws or the Maritime Code.
port regulation — the legal standards and regulations applicable to ports, based primarily on municipal laws, port laws or the Maritime Code. McKinsey's Skill Change Index places it in the evolving band (SCI 50.68/100) — the skill will still matter in 2030 but the nature of the work is changing. ESCO classifies it as a sector-specific (rooted in one industry) skill within knowledge. It is currently listed by 3 occupations in our catalogue, including port coordinator, stevedore superintendent, and water traffic coordinator.
